1986 Lancia Thema vs. 2000 Peugeot 306

To start off, 2000 Peugeot 306 is newer by 14 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1986 Lancia Thema.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1986 Lancia Thema would be higher. At 1,994 cc (4 cylinders), 1986 Lancia Thema is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1986 Lancia Thema (120 HP @ 5250 RPM) has 20 more horse power than 2000 Peugeot 306. (100 HP @ 5750 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1986 Lancia Thema should accelerate faster than 2000 Peugeot 306.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2000 Peugeot 306 weights approximately 60 kg more than 1986 Lancia Thema.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1986 Lancia Thema (165 Nm @ 3300 RPM) has 30 more torque (in Nm) than 2000 Peugeot 306. (135 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 1986 Lancia Thema will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2000 Peugeot 306.
